How they compare
Armenia currently reports 3 years against 3 years in India, a difference of 0 years.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 22 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Armenia ahead.
Armenia ranks 101st and India ranks 101st of 204 countries.
Armenia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Armenia | India |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 4 years | 3 years | 1 years | Armenia |
| 2000s | 4 years | 3 years | 1 years | Armenia |
| 2010s | 3.1 years | 3 years | 0.1 years | Armenia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
